>> P.S. USB has a practical distance limit of 10 feet, where ethernet is
>> 300 or so. I keep hammering on the CCD folks to go ethernet, but the
>> only feedback I've gotten it that everyone else wants USB.
>>
>
>
> I agree with you totally. USB is not the panacea that some think. It
> is limited in cable length unless you use various extenders and
> converters.
>
> It is sad that half way measures are the norm in the astronomy
> industry.
>
> Doc G

I have done so thinking about the approach to making a CCD camera an
Ethernet device. The key is that it will be necessary to be able to
store a full image in the device itself. This is not at all out of the
question for typical micros but does mean a special memory since the
directly addressable memory space is too small in most cases. I may try
to build such a mod for an st-8 this summer.
